SSL Strageness Solved

I have been struggling to get SSL to work Minivend. I finally got it to
work. The problem was that the path to the secure site for my hosting
company (cihost.com) is:
machine.secureserver.com/cgi-mysite/simple
^^^^^^
This caused Minivend to somehow generate the path:
/cgi-mysite/mysite/simple
^^^^^^^
I still don't know why it's adding that second "mysite" in there. The
solution was to add another alias to the Catalog directive in minivend.cfg
to the weird, non-existant path:
Catalog simple /home/mysite/catalogs/simple /cgi-bin/simple
/cgi-mysite/simple /cgi-mysite/mysite/simple
I tried making a symlink to my /cgi-bin directory called /cgi-mysite and
made all references to be for /cgi-mysite/simple, but then I got an extra,
even weirder path of /cgi-mysite/mysite/mysite/simple.
I guess Minivend figures the paths will be something like to following:
www.mysite.com/cgi-bin/simple
www.secureserver.com/mysite/cgi-bin/simple
So I guess the moral to the story is: when specifying a secure server, if
Minivend gives errors that weird paths that don't exist, try adding the
weird paths as aliases.
